What Is Wash Trading?

Wash trading involves executing trades to create misleading market activity, commonly to inflate the appearance of high demand or trading volume. This practice is typically carried out by traders or entities buying and selling the same asset to themselves, thereby giving the impression of increased liquidity and market interest.

Wash Trading on Solana: How It Works

The Solana blockchain, known for its high throughput and low transaction fees, unfortunately, also provides an environment where wash trading can occur easily. Traders may exploit these features to generate a high number of transactions to simulate liquidity. While Solana's architecture promotes efficiency and speed, it also requires vigilant monitoring to ensure transparency and authenticity in trading activities.
